Understanding Outpatient Alcohol and Drug Rehab Facilities in Dixie, Georgia

While grappling with drug and alcohol addiction, you might decide to seek treatment. This means that you should examine all of your options for substance abuse treatment.

Depending on the specifics and circumstances of your addiction, you might set your mind on medically managed detoxification or even choose inpatient alcohol and drug treatment. However, many addicts find that they are best suited to attend an outpatient substance abuse treatment center.

Although each of the treatment options mentioned above - detox and inpatient care - are constructed to treat addiction through different stages of recovery, you will generally find that outpatient drug and alcohol treatment often comes as the last step that you should take in the full continuum of rehabilitation and care.

When you enter into an outpatient addiction treatment center, you will still have the option to continue living at home. At the same time, however, you will be required to participate in your addiction treatment at certain hours.

Through this form of treatment in Dixie, you may enjoy greater freedom in your recovery. This means that you might still be able to maintain your job as well as continue taking care of your daily duties to family, friends, and your social life.

When you join one of these programs, however, you may benefit from spending some time every day meeting with therapists and staff counselors.

That said, the length of outpatient drug treatment will vary significantly from a few weeks to about three months. This is because this is the period when most addicts have the highest risk of relapsing.

Overall, the time you spend will largely depend on how you are progressing in your recovery, your physical health, and mental stability. As long as you are focused on outpatient drug rehab and do not allow any external distractions to hinder your abstinence and sobriety, you can succeed in the long term.
